Top 20 Natural Monuments around Oekingen

Best natural monuments around Oekingen include preserved natural areas and the Oesch river, offering local ecological significance. The region, part of the municipality of Kriegstetten in Solothurn, Switzerland, features dedicated nature trails like the Oeschtrail. This trail highlights local flora and fauna, providing both educational and recreational value. Visitors can explore a variety of natural features, from river landscapes to elevated viewpoints.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are some of the most popular natural monuments around Oekingen?

Visitors frequently enjoy the unique views from Balmfluechöpfli Summit and the wild, romantic landscape of Verenaschlucht and Hermitage. Another favorite is Emmenspitz – Confluence of the Emme and Aare, known for its scenic river views and picnic spots.

Are there family-friendly natural monuments or activities in the Oekingen area?

Yes, several natural monuments are suitable for families. The Verenaschlucht and Hermitage offers an easy, well-developed path through a gorge. Emmenspitz – Confluence of the Emme and Aare has seating and a barbecue area perfect for a family break. Additionally, Lake Burgäschi features a lido and swimming opportunities. The local Oeschtrail is also designed with interactive elements and riddles, making it engaging for all ages.

What kind of natural features can I expect to see around Oekingen?

The region offers a diverse range of natural features. You can explore dramatic gorges like Verenaschlucht, enjoy panoramic views from summits such as Balmfluechöpfli and Oberbühlchnubel, and experience serene river landscapes at Emmenspitz. There's also the tranquil Lake Burgäschi, surrounded by forest and reeds, designated as a nature reserve.

What is the best time to visit the natural monuments around Oekingen?

The natural monuments are enjoyable throughout the year. For places like Verenaschlucht, summer offers pleasant conditions, but visiting off-season can provide a quieter experience. Generally, spring and autumn offer mild weather ideal for hiking and exploring, while summer is great for activities around Lake Burgäschi.

Are there any historical or cultural sites integrated with the natural monuments?

Yes, the Verenaschlucht and Hermitage is a notable example. This gorge features a hermitage and two chapels, offering a blend of natural beauty and historical significance. The local Oeschtrail also incorporates insights into Oekingen's history alongside its focus on nature.

Can I bring my dog to the natural monuments?

Many natural areas are dog-friendly, but leash rules may apply. For instance, at Lake Burgäschi, there is a leash obligation for dogs. It's always best to check local signage or specific highlight details for regulations regarding pets.

Are there places to eat or have a break near the natural monuments?

Yes, you'll find options for refreshments. Near Verenaschlucht, there are three restaurants. Lake Burgäschi is home to the highly recommended "Gasthaus Seeblick am Burgäschisee." Additionally, Emmenspitz offers a barbecue area and seating for a pleasant break.

How can I reach the natural monuments around Oekingen using public transport?

Some natural monuments are accessible by public transport. For example, the Verenaschlucht and Hermitage can be reached from Solothurn by bus (line 4, stop St. Niklaus). For other locations, local bus services might be available, or a short walk from the nearest village center may be required.
